你查询的IP:[122.51.70.68]  地理位置:中国–上海–上海

最新查询123.178.13.104 202.127.200.84 121.56.99.92 121.16.137.24 119.8.77.35 218.56.121.196 222.64.160.139 114.60.132.59 221.12.46.244 124.29.205.164 122.51.70.68 222.64.96.145 123.108.128.92 202.173.8.203 221.12.128.208 117.53.176.56 58.87.64.168 123.177.120.211 202.73.110.186 61.128.226.201 161.207.169.187 202.91.196.159 220.234.199.36 58.82.167.19 118.66.61.132 58.144.169.252 116.196.126.79 121.224.131.223 124.72.7.28 119.164.62.91 61.29.128.95 203.128.32.101